What is the RIT Freshman Admission Application?
The RIT Freshman Admission Application serves as a crucial gateway for prospective undergraduate students seeking admission to the Rochester Institute of Technology. This application process facilitates enrollment into various academic programs, allowing students to showcase their qualifications and aspirations effectively. It typically includes sections where applicants provide personal information, academic records, and standardized test scores, which are essential for assessing eligibility for admission.

Who Needs the RIT Freshman Admission Application?
The RIT Freshman Admission Application is designed for prospective undergraduate students, including both domestic and international applicants. Certain specialized programs may require additional qualifications, such as submission of a portfolio for art-related fields or specific forms for audiology admissions. Understanding eligibility criteria is essential for all applicants to ensure proper completion of the application.

What are the eligibility requirements for the RIT Freshman Admission Application?
To apply for the RIT Freshman Admission Application, you must be a high school senior or equivalent. You'll need to have a strong academic record and meet specific program requirements, including test scores.
When is the application deadline for prospective students?
The application deadline for the RIT Freshman Admission varies yearly. It's crucial to check RIT’s official admissions website for the most current deadlines to ensure timely submission.
What supporting documents are required for submission?
Required supporting documents may include your high school transcript, standardized test scores, letters of recommendation, and, depending on your chosen program, additional materials such as an art portfolio.

What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the admission application?
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, incorrect spelling of names, misreporting test scores, and not following instructions for specific programs. Always double-check your entries before submission.
